5/06/2008 - PHP 4 End-Of-Life Plans for all Linux Users - UPDATED
Posted on 22/06/08 11:29pm
Important Information for ALL PHP 4 Users on ALL Linux Users.
As you may be aware, PHP developer support for PHP 4 was discontinued on the 31/12/2007. While our hosting providers will continue to support PHP 4 sites during early to mid 2008, PHP 4 itself will only receive select security updates until 08/08/2008 and from then on it will no longer have security updates released. All new Linux websites setup from the 5/06/2008 will now be setup by default as PHP 5.
UPDATE: PHP 4 will be phased out on the on the cPanel Servers (Concorde and Libra servers) on the 15th August 08, so please make sure your scripts that use PHP 4 will work with PHP 5 before the switch over date.

29/01/2008 - FOLDER PERMISSIONS
Posted on 22/06/08 11:24pm
Over the past couple of days we seen reports in the news, that a number of websites in NZ have fallen victim to hackers due to wide open permissions (777) on directories and files or out of date CMS installations. We would like to remind all clients that 3rd party software on your site is your responsability and to make sure files are not world writable.
